The Rise of Ben Askren in Combat Sports

Born on July 18, 1984, in Cedar Rapids, Iowa, Ben Askren was destined for greatness in the world of wrestling. He began competing at a young age and quickly established himself as a formidable opponent. His high school success paved the way for a stellar collegiate career.

A Wrestling Phenom

Askren's collegiate wrestling career was nothing short of extraordinary. He was a two-time NCAA Division I national champion at the University of Missouri and a two-time Big 12 Conference champion. His accolades include:

  • Two-time NCAA Division I Champion (2006, 2007)
  • Two-time Big 12 Champion
  • Member of the 2008 U.S. Olympic Wrestling Team

His wrestling background provided the perfect foundation for a transition into MMA, where he would leave an indelible mark.

Transition to MMA

In 2009, Ben Askren embarked on his MMA career, quickly making a name for himself in the sport. With his grappling skills and relentless fighting style, Askren dominated his opponents, remaining unbeaten for an impressive 20 fights before joining the UFC in 2019. His tenure in Bellator and ONE Championship showcased his ability to adapt and thrive against diverse fighting styles.

UFC Journey and Retirement

Askren's move to the UFC was historic. In a rare fighter exchange, the UFC traded their flyweight champion, Demetrious Johnson, to ONE Championship in exchange for Askren. This unprecedented deal shocked the MMA world and set the stage for Askren's UFC debut against Robbie Lawler, which he won via technical knockout. Health Crisis: A Sudden Turn of Events

Fast forward to early 2023, and Askren's life took an unexpected turn. After experiencing severe pneumonia, he was hospitalized in Wisconsin, where his condition worsened. Just weeks prior, Askren had been in good health, highlighting the unpredictability of illness.

The Road to Recovery

On the brink of a critical health crisis, Askren was placed on a ventilator and subsequently added to the transplant list for a double lung transplant. His wife, Amy, shared the news on social media, expressing gratitude for the donor and their family, emphasizing the beginning of a new chapter for Ben.

Community Support

In a display of camaraderie, fellow fighters and fans rallied around Askren during this challenging time. Notably, Jake Paul, who famously defeated Askren in a boxing match in 2021, made a public plea for donations to aid in his recovery. This act of solidarity underscores the tight-knit nature of the MMA community, where rivalries often give way to support during personal crises.
